Followers: 20,000 particles

I've been playing around with vectors and decided to see how many particles I could get to follow my mouse using bitmap data. Using 300,000 particles (nearly half a million) I clocked around 2fps, I decided to add a few more effects (colours, trigonometry for the following etc) and found the simulation to run at max fps up until around 20,000. Not bad at all and some of the effects look really pretty!
